2

Paradox (Olivia)

Best for: Vehicle title loan companies with high-volume branch hiring needs (100+ frontline roles monthly) seeking conversational automation for screening and scheduling

Paradox, powered by its conversational AI assistant Olivia, is widely recognized for automating high-volume frontline hiring through 24/7 candidate engagement via SMS, WhatsApp, and web chat. According to multiple 2026 industry analyses, Olivia handles candidate screening, interview scheduling, FAQ responses, and onboarding coordination without human intervention — compressing multi-day back-and-forth into minutes. For vehicle title loan companies with branch networks hiring customer service representatives, collections agents, and tellers at scale, Paradox’s strength lies in its ability to manage thousands of simultaneous candidate conversations while integrating with major ATS platforms including Greenhouse, Workday, and iCIMS. The platform’s multilingual support and mobile-first experience align with the diverse candidate pools common in retail lending footprints. However, Paradox is primarily built for high-volume hourly roles and may not address the specialized screening needs of underwriting, compliance, or licensed lending positions that require deeper competency evaluation. Pricing is quote-based and typically structured per-hire or per-employee, requiring direct engagement with their sales team for accurate cost modeling.

3

Workable

Best for: Growing vehicle title loan companies (10–500 employees) needing a comprehensive, easy-to-deploy ATS with built-in AI sourcing, screening, and workflow automation

Workable earns its position as a top all-in-one recruiting platform with built-in AI features purpose-built for SMB and mid-market teams. According to TechnologyAdvice’s 2026 evaluation scoring 4.61/5 overall, Workable’s autonomous recruiting agent can source passive candidates from a database of over 400 million profiles, evaluate applicants against ideal candidate profiles, qualify prospects, and communicate with candidates through chat. For vehicle title loan companies with lean HR teams (10–500 employees), Workable’s strength is its unified platform combining job distribution to 200+ boards, AI-powered candidate matching and ranking, automated screening, interview scheduling with self-booking links, scorecards, offer management, and reporting — all without stitching together multiple tools. The platform publishes transparent AI credit pricing: evaluating a candidate uses 1 credit, sourcing uses 2 credits, and a candidate chat uses 10 credits, enabling predictable cost forecasting. Starting at $149/month (per monday.com 2026 data) or $189/month for Starter plan (per Intervue 2026 data), Workable balances affordability with comprehensive functionality. However, reporting and governance constraints surface as teams grow, video interviews and assessments are paid add-ons, and heavy AI usage can increase costs significantly.

4

Greenhouse

Best for: Mid-market to enterprise vehicle title loan companies with dedicated TA teams prioritizing hiring consistency, compliance, and data-driven process governance

Greenhouse is the established leader for mid-market and enterprise teams prioritizing structured, equitable hiring with governance-grade AI. Greenhouse’s own 2026 guide positions its platform as delivering "end-to-end structured hiring workflows with responsible AI innovation built in," embedding AI throughout the hiring lifecycle including conversational/voice AI and governed MCP connectivity for agents. For vehicle title loan companies with mature TA functions and compliance obligations, Greenhouse excels at structured interview scorecards with bias-reduction prompts, DEI-focused analytics, customizable automation rules for candidate progression, and advanced reporting dashboards tracking time-to-fill, source quality, and pipeline velocity. Its open API ecosystem connects seamlessly with specialized tools for technical assessments, background checks, and video interviewing. However, Greenhouse requires significant implementation investment and is not suited for teams needing activation in days — typical deployments involve dedicated recruiting ops resources. Pricing is custom, typically $6,000–$25,000+ annually depending on company size (per Intervue 2026 data), with no public self-serve tiers. The platform’s strength is process rigor and compliance defensibility, making it a strong fit for regulated lenders with established hiring infrastructure.

5

hireEZ

Best for: Vehicle title loan companies with dedicated sourcing needs for hard-to-fill specialized or licensed roles, seeking proactive outbound pipeline automation

hireEZ (formerly Hiretual) specializes in proactive sourcing, CRM, and outreach automation for mid-market and enterprise recruiting teams. According to Greenhouse’s 2026 comparison and Built In’s 2026 analysis, hireEZ provides AI contact discovery across multiple data sources with automated outreach sequences, accessing an 800M+ profile database with diversity filters. For vehicle title loan companies struggling to fill specialized roles — licensed loan officers, compliance analysts, repossession coordinators, or regional managers — hireEZ’s strength is talent rediscovery and outbound pipeline building. The platform combines candidate search across 45+ platforms (LinkedIn, GitHub, Stack Overflow, Behance), AI matching against role briefs, personalized multi-touch email campaigns with A/B testing, and native ATS integrations for Greenhouse, Lever, Workday, and Bullhorn. However, documented LinkedIn account restriction risk and uneven contact data accuracy (G2 reviewers flag bounce rates up to 30% on some segments) require verification before high-volume sequences. Pricing is quote-based starting around $494/month per HeroHunt’s 2026 re-check (up from widely quoted $169). hireEZ is best deployed as a sourcing intelligence layer atop a core ATS, not a standalone hiring platform.

Is hireEZ a full hiring platform or a sourcing add-on?

hireEZ is primarily a sourcing intelligence layer — AI-powered candidate discovery, matching, and automated outreach across 800M+ profiles — designed to sit atop a core ATS (Greenhouse, Lever, Workday, Bullhorn). It does not replace an ATS for workflow management, interview scheduling, offer management, or hiring analytics. Vehicle title loan companies should evaluate it as a supplement for hard-to-fill specialized roles, not a standalone recruiting platform.

What should a vehicle title loan company prioritize when evaluating AI recruiting platforms in 2026?

Prioritize: (1) Compliance-first architecture with audit trails, bias monitoring, and FCRA/EEOC alignment for regulated lending roles; (2) Integration depth with your loan origination system, background check providers, and HRIS; (3) Workflow fit — does the platform improve your existing process or create new friction?; (4) Transparency and explainability — can you see, adjust, and override AI decisions?; (5) Total cost of ownership including implementation, AI usage credits, and ongoing governance; (6) Vendor viability — confirmed by the 2026 consolidation wave (HireVue acquired Modern Hire, Workday bought HiredScore, Entelo became Rival Recruit).
